Unveiling Data's Secrets: An Exploratory Journey
Exploratory Data Analysis (EDA) is a crucial stage in the data science process. It involves tools to summarize and represent data, revealing hidden patterns and associations. Through EDA, we can discover outliers, shifts, and associations that may not be immediately visible. This journey is essential for gaining insights, developing hypotheses, and informing further analysis.

Financial Analysis
Determining the success of an investment requires a meticulous examination of its monetary performance. Analysts utilize various methods to gauge the yield generated by an investment over a particular timeframe. Key variables analyzed include total returns, risk, and the alignment between an investment's results and its original objectives.
Thorough financial analysis provides investors with incisive information to optimize their portfolio strategies. It allows them to identify high-performing investments and reduce potential threats.
